Knowing when it's advisable to remove a tree

There are a variety of signs that can let you know a tree should be taken out.

Damage to half or more of the tree

When there is a lot of damage to 50% or more of the tree that is visible from the terrain it is a likely signal that you may want to have it cut down.

Main trunk is cracked

When the trunk of the tree is cracked or broken vertically, it impairs the tree significantly, and it should be taken out. Vertical fractures can additionally be a signal that there is decomposition inside the tree.

A big branch has broken

If a large branch or tree limb has broken off from the tree, this will generally result in severe decomposition and weaken the tree a lot. It could be a good idea to have it removed.

Dead Roots

Dead, broken down, or weakened roots will cause a tree to be unsteady, lean and fall over. This can be dangerous and it is a wise idea to remove the tree.

Tree is Leaning

When a tree is leaning, it is at risk of falling down, and can be hazardous. Falling over into a building, telephone pole, street, or onto a person can be a serious issue. Safety should always be a top priority.

Dead Trees

Dead trees can rapidly become infested with pests such as termites, rats, ants, and wood boring bugs. This infestation can rapidly spread to your home, and other neighboring trees or buildings. It’s wise to have a dead tree removal company cut out the tree before it causes further damages.
